How We Rank Schools

Every school list on this site is ordered by the BOC Score, computed from the most recent school-level data published by the U.S. Department of Education (College Scorecard and IPEDS). To qualify, a school must be currently operating and accredited by an agency recognized by the U.S. Department of Education. Each eligible school is then scored on five measures, percentile-ranked against schools at the same credential level:

  • Graduation rate 30%
  • Median earnings, 10 years after entry 25%
  • Average net price (lower is better) 20%
  • Retention rate 15%
  • Fully online availability 10%

Schools without enough outcome data appear after ranked schools, without a score. On this page, schools are ordered by distance from Gladstone. Advertising never affects these rankings. Read the full methodology.

Geography Wages Near Gladstone

Gladstone is part of the Kansas City, MO-KS metro area (BLS area code 28140). Where MSA-level wages are published, the table below shows MSA medians; otherwise it falls back to Missouri statewide.

Occupation Median Wage Source COL-Adjusted (US=100)
Geographers $102,040 MO statewide $110,314
Cartographers and Photogrammetrists $101,810 Kansas City, MO-KS $110,065
Surveyors $73,780 Kansas City, MO-KS $79,762
Urban and Regional Planners $84,520 Kansas City, MO-KS $91,373
Geoscientists, Except Hydrologists and Geographers $90,060 Kansas City, MO-KS $97,362
Geography Teachers, Postsecondary $83,530 MO statewide $90,303
Environmental Scientists and Specialists, Including Health $80,690 Kansas City, MO-KS $87,232
Computer Occupations, All Other $105,470 Kansas City, MO-KS $114,022

Source: BLS, May 2025 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.
